Cedar House Staining in Longmont, CO
Cedar house sta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to cedar exteriors, such as siding, fences, decks, and gazebos. This process enhances the appearance of cedar surfaces by highlighting their natural grain and color, while also providing a barrier against weather elements like moisture, sun damage, and pests. Property owners often request cedar staining to maintain the aesthetic appeal of their homes, extend the lifespan of their wood features, and improve curb appeal.
Before requesting cedar house staining, homeowners typically want to understand the condition of their existing wood surfaces, the types of stains or finishes available, and the best application methods for their specific property. It is also useful to consider the timing of the stain application, especially in relation to weather conditions, and to inquire about proper surface preparation to ensure a long-lasting and even finish. Proper guidance can help property owners make informed decisions to preserve their cedar features effectively.

Cedar House Staining Questions
What types of cedar surfaces can be stained? Cedar staining services typically include decks, fences, siding, and pergolas, enhancing their appearance and durability.
How does staining protect cedar wood? Staining creates a protective barrier against moisture, UV rays, and weathering, helping to extend the life of cedar structures.
What are common color options for cedar staining? A variety of stain colors are available, from transparent and semi-transparent to solid finishes, allowing for customization of the look.
Is cedar staining suitable for new or existing structures? Cedar staining can be applied to both new and older structures to refresh and preserve their appearance.
